Fortunately, congressional Republicans have introduced <a href=\"https:\/\/mcusercontent.com\/ffedde7e54b71a41a9505fff1\/files\/66aa6f96-22dc-3da6-1bc4-5b3d5c2349b9\/HINSON_005_xml.pdf\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">legislation<\/a> to address this issue.<\/p>\n<p>Since 2014, the Chinese Communist Party has expanded its reach overseas, targeting Chinese nationals regardless of their residence or immigration status. This initiative includes programs like &ldquo;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.propublica.org\/article\/operation-fox-hunt-how-china-exports-repression-using-a-network-of-spies-hidden-in-plain-sight\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Operation Fox Hunt<\/a>&rdquo; and &ldquo;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.independent.co.uk\/news\/world\/asia\/operation-skynet-china-s-anticorruption-campaign-goes-international-as-beijing-reaches-out-to-uncover-officials-fled-abroad-10142310.html\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Operation Skynet<\/a>,&rdquo; where China&rsquo;s Ministry of Public Security (MPS) sends undercover police to foreign countries to forcibly repatriate individuals labeled as &ldquo;criminals&rdquo; by any means necessary.<\/p>\n<p>According to one <a href=\"https:\/\/www.propublica.org\/article\/operation-fox-hunt-how-china-exports-repression-using-a-network-of-spies-hidden-in-plain-sight\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">report<\/a>, to compel these individuals to return, Chinese authorities &ldquo;subject their relatives in China to harassment, jail, torture and other mistreatment, sometimes recording hostage-like videos to send to the United States. In countries like&nbsp;Vietnam&nbsp;and Australia, Chinese agents have simply abducted their prey.&rdquo;<\/p>\n<p>Additionally,&nbsp;the Spain-based NGO Safeguard Defenders has <a href=\"https:\/\/safeguarddefenders.com\/sites\/default\/files\/pdf\/Patrol%20and%20Persuade%20v2.pdf\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">revealed<\/a> alarming evidence that China&rsquo;s notorious MPS has established over 100 &ldquo;Overseas Police Stations&rdquo; in more than 50 countries, including the United States. While these stations claim to offer essential services, such as legal aid for Chinese expatriate communities, their actual purpose is far more insidious: to monitor, intimidate, and silence overseas Chinese individuals, while aiding China&rsquo;s efforts to capture alleged fugitives globally.<\/p>\n<p>These illicit policing activities raise serious concerns. The CCP uses a broad definition of &ldquo;criminals,&rdquo; often <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/bidens-trans-policies-are-putting-men-in-womens-prisons-and-kicking-christians-out-of-law-enforcement\/\" title=\"Biden\u2019s Trans Policies Are Putting Men In Women\u2019s Prisons And Kicking Christians Out Of Law Enforcement\">targeting political dissenters<\/a> and threatening their right to free expression through surveillance and harassment. Additionally, the forced repatriation of individuals to China without due process is a clear violation of human rights. Alarmingly, many nations were initially unaware of these covert operations, highlighting the CCP&rsquo;s troubling disregard for national sovereignty.<\/p>\n<p>The U.S. government has taken some actions to address China&rsquo;s illegal policing activities in the U.S.<\/p>\n<p>Three individuals &mdash; including American private investigator Michael McMahon and two Chinese citizens residing in the United States &mdash; were arrested in 2020 and later <a href=\"https:\/\/apnews.com\/article\/china-repatriation-operation-fox-hunt-trial-new-york-01f96f6952e772efb5814c12316922dc\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">convicted<\/a> in 2023 of crimes related to their pressuring a Chinese expatriate living in New Jersey to return to China. The defense attorneys for the three men argued that the U.S. government should have increased public awareness regarding Beijing&rsquo;s deceptive tactics, as their clients believed they were assisting a company or an individual in collecting debts, unaware that the Chinese government was involved.<\/p>\n<p>In April 2023, the Department of Justice <a href=\"https:\/\/www.justice.gov\/archives\/opa\/pr\/two-arrested-operating-illegal-overseas-police-station-chinese-government\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">arrested<\/a> New York City residents Lu Jianwang and Chen Jinping, charging them with opening and operating a Chinese police station in lower Manhattan, New York. Chen <a href=\"https:\/\/abcnews.go.com\/US\/guilty-plea-expected-secret-chinese-police-station-case\/story?id=116907684\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">pleaded guilty<\/a> in 2024, while Lu is still awaiting trial.<\/p>\n<p>Additionally, the DOJ <a href=\"https:\/\/www.justice.gov\/archives\/opa\/pr\/40-officers-china-s-national-police-charged-transnational-repression-schemes-targeting-us\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">indicted<\/a> 40 officers of China&rsquo;s MPS and two members of the Cyberspace Administration of China (CAC), alleging that they harassed Chinese nationals living in the U.S. who are critical of the CCP. These Chinese officers have likely acted under the directive of <a href=\"https:\/\/thefederalist.com\/2022\/04\/15\/hunter-bidens-laptops-scandal-exposes-how-communist-influence-operations-work\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">the United Front Work Department (UFWD)<\/a>, a semi-secret organization within the CCP responsible for disseminating party propaganda and managing influence campaigns both domestically and internationally.<\/p>\n<p>The DOJ <a href=\"https:\/\/www.justice.gov\/archives\/opa\/pr\/40-officers-china-s-national-police-charged-transnational-repression-schemes-targeting-us\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">emphasized<\/a> that &ldquo;these cases demonstrate the lengths the PRC government will go to silence and harass U.S. persons who exercise their fundamental rights to speak out against PRC oppression. &hellip; These actions violate our laws and are an affront to our democratic values and basic human rights.&rdquo;<\/p>\n<p>Yet during President Joe Biden&rsquo;s multiple meetings with General Secretary Xi Jinping, Biden never demanded that China stop its illegal policing on U.S. soil.&nbsp; Now, congressional Republicans seek to end China&rsquo;s illegal policing in the U.S. through legislation.<\/p>\n<p>Sen.
